The Biodiesel Market was valued at USD 52.56 billion in 2025 and is projected to grow to USD 54.24 billion in 2026, with a CAGR of 3.98%, reaching USD 69.09 billion by 2032.

KEY MARKET STATISTICS
Base Year [2025] USD 52.56 billion
Estimated Year [2026] USD 54.24 billion
Forecast Year [2032] USD 69.09 billion
CAGR (%) 3.98%

Detailed exploration of the structural shifts reshaping biodiesel markets driven by feedstock diversification, technology evolution, and changing demand patterns

The industry is experiencing transformative shifts driven by a convergence of decarbonization mandates, technological maturation, and shifting feedstock economics that collectively reconfigure value chains and investment priorities.

First, feedstock sourcing is no longer a single-axis consideration: producers are integrating waste cooking oil collection networks, scaling animal fat processing streams including lard, poultry fat, and tallow, and piloting algae-derived routes that distinguish between macroalgae and microalgae for yield and processing characteristics. These moves reduce exposure to commodity vegetable oil price swings while responding to sustainability criteria imposed by regulators and offtakers. Second, production technologies have diversified. Beyond traditional transesterification, catalytic and non-catalytic variants, the adoption of in situ transesterification-both heterogeneous and homogeneous-and ultrasonic-assisted processes with high and low frequency options is enabling lower solvent usage, accelerated reaction times, and opportunities for decentralized or modular plants.

Third, end-market demand profiles are shifting. Transportation fuel applications now require clear assessment of on-road and off-road compatibility, while power generation buyers evaluate co-firing versus diesel generator use-cases. Industrial buyers are increasingly sensitive to purity grades from B100 through B7 and their implications for maintenance cycles and warranty compliance. Finally, distribution dynamics are transforming with growth in direct-to-manufacturer online channels, B2B platforms, and more sophisticated distributor relationships, prompting suppliers to adopt integrated logistics and digital traceability solutions. Together, these shifts demand coordinated strategic responses across procurement, process engineering, and commercial functions.

Analysis of how the cumulative tariff measures in 2025 forced supply chain redesign, sourcing diversification, and a strategic pivot toward modular resilient production models

The imposition of tariffs in 2025 created a new layer of commercial calculus that alters supply chain design, sourcing priorities, and competitive dynamics across domestic and cross-border trade relationships.

Tariff measures have prompted buyers and producers to revisit supplier contracts and to accelerate sourcing diversification away from tariff-exposed routes. Firms operating vertically integrated models have captured resilience advantages by internalizing feedstock processing and minimizing import dependencies. At the same time, traders and distributors adapted by developing near-shore partnerships and increasing reliance on feedstocks that are less affected by duties, such as locally collected waste cooking oil and domestically processed animal fats, thereby shortening logistical chains and reducing exposure to tariff volatility.

Investment behavior also shifted: capital that might previously have supported large centralized refineries has redirected into modular and distributed production assets that can operate profitably under a higher duty regime. Concurrently, technology selection has been influenced by the tariff environment; producers favor processes that increase feedstock flexibility and lower operating costs, such as heterogeneous in situ transesterification and ultrasonic-assisted systems. The resulting cumulative effect is a market that prizes supply chain agility and technological adaptability, with commercial contracts increasingly structured to hedge against future policy changes and to preserve margin resilience in a tariff-impacted landscape.

In-depth segmentation insights showing how feedstock selection, purity grades, application demands, distribution channels, and technology choices determine competitive advantage

A granular view of segmentation reveals actionable differentiation across feedstock types, purity grades, application areas, distribution pathways, and technology platforms, each influencing strategic choice and operational performance.

Feedstock considerations extend from algae-based approaches-where macroalgae and microalgae routes present distinct cultivation, harvesting, and oil extraction trade-offs-to traditional vegetable oils like palm oil, rapeseed oil, soybean oil, and sunflower oil that remain significant but face sustainability scrutiny. Animal fat inputs, ranging from lard to poultry fat and tallow, offer cost advantages and stable glyceride profiles, while waste cooking oil provides a circular pathway with strong sustainability credentials but requires more rigorous collection and decontamination logistics. Purity grade segmentation, specifically B100, B20, and B7, determines compatibility with existing engine fleets and affects warranty and maintenance regimes; higher purity grades favor fleet owners pursuing aggressive emissions targets, whereas lower blends often serve as drop-in solutions that minimize operational disruption.

In application terms, industrial solvents, power generation use-cases including co-firing and diesel generators, and transportation fuel applications divided into off-road and on-road contexts create distinct demand patterns and contractual norms. Distribution channel dynamics-spanning traditional distributors, direct end users such as automotive OEMs and independent repair shops, and online retail channels including B2B platforms and manufacturer-direct routes-shape go-to-market strategies, margin structures, and traceability requirements. Technology segmentation further informs capital and operational choices: In situ transesterification, available in heterogeneous and homogeneous configurations, can reduce processing stages, whereas catalytic and non-catalytic transesterification approaches offer differing reagent and waste profiles. Ultrasonic technologies, delivered in high frequency and low frequency variants, can accelerate reaction kinetics and enable scale-flexible deployments. Synthesizing these segmentation layers helps leaders prioritize investment in logistics, process control, and partnerships that align with their commercial and sustainability objectives.

Regional dynamics and regulatory nuances that determine feedstock access, certification demands, and distribution strategies across the Americas, EMEA, and Asia-Pacific

Regional dynamics continue to exert a profound influence on strategy, with distinct regulatory, feedstock, and infrastructure conditions shaping competitive behavior across major geographies.

In the Americas, producers and fuel consumers navigate an environment characterized by varied state-level policies, established waste oil collection ecosystems, and a strong legacy of animal fat processing capacity. These factors favor flexible production models and create opportunities for partnerships between collectors, refiners, and logistics providers. Meanwhile, Europe, Middle East & Africa present a complex mosaic: stringent sustainability reporting and certification regimes in some European markets drive demand for traceable feedstock and higher-purity blends, while emerging markets within the broader region exhibit uneven infrastructure and growing interest in modular systems suited to local feedstock availability. Policy frameworks and carbon pricing signals in this region also catalyze innovation in feedstock conversion pathways.

Across the Asia-Pacific, rapid industrialization and expanding transport fleets generate rising energy demand and strong interest in feedstock diversification. Established vegetable oil industries in parts of the region offer both opportunities and sustainability concerns, prompting innovators to explore algae cultivation and enhanced waste oil recovery as alternative inputs. Infrastructure bottlenecks and heterogeneous fuel standards in different markets require adaptive distribution strategies and close collaboration with local OEMs and fuel retailers. Taken together, these regional nuances call for tailored commercial models, localized technical solutions, and partnerships that reflect regulatory and supply-chain realities specific to each geography.

Strategic corporate behaviors and competitive positioning highlighting vertical integration, technology alliances, and traceability investments that influence market leadership

Competitive and strategic behavior among leading firms underscores the importance of integrated operations, technology partnerships, and forward-looking sustainability commitments.

Across the value chain, vertically integrated producers that combine feedstock sourcing, processing, and distribution demonstrate greater control over margin and compliance, enabling them to respond more rapidly to shifts in feedstock availability and policy. Strategic partnerships between technology licensors, equipment manufacturers, and feedstock aggregators have accelerated the commercialization of process innovations such as ultrasonic-assisted reaction systems and modular transesterification units. At the same time, several market participants have invested in verification and traceability platforms to validate sustainable sourcing claims and to meet evolving buyer expectations.

New entrants and specialized operators focus on niche advantages-such as advanced algae cultivation, high-efficiency decontamination of waste cooking oil, or region-specific logistics optimization-while incumbent refiners emphasize scale, regulatory experience, and long-term offtake relationships. Mergers, joint ventures, and off-take agreements increasingly center on securing diversified feedstock baskets and on translating technological capability into consistent product quality across B100, B20, and B7 offerings. Taken together, these strategic moves create a competitive environment where agility, technological depth, and validated sustainability credentials distinguish leaders from followers.
